Qbrick Past Earnings Performance

Past criteria checks 0/6

Qbrick's earnings have been declining at an average annual rate of -33.5%, while the Software industry saw earnings growing at 20.3% annually. Revenues have been declining at an average rate of 7.2% per year.

Quality Earnings: QBRICK is currently unprofitable.

Growing Profit Margin: QBRICK is currently unprofitable.


Free Cash Flow vs Earnings Analysis


Past Earnings Growth Analysis

Earnings Trend: QBRICK is unprofitable, and losses have increased over the past 5 years at a rate of 33.5% per year.

Accelerating Growth: Unable to compare QBRICK's earnings growth over the past year to its 5-year average as it is currently unprofitable

Earnings vs Industry: QBRICK is unprofitable, making it difficult to compare its past year earnings growth to the Software industry (26.3%).


Return on Equity

High ROE: QBRICK has a negative Return on Equity (-48.2%), as it is currently unprofitable.
